Top 5 Apple Arcade Games on iOS in Central America: Q3 2025
Explore the performance of the top 5 Apple Arcade games on iOS in Central America during Q3 2025, with insights into downloads, revenue, and active users.
In the third quarter of 2025, the top Apple Arcade games on iOS in Central America showcased varied performance metrics. This analysis, based on data from Sensor Tower, highlights key trends in weekly downloads, revenue, and active user statistics.
Chess - Play & Learn Online from Chess.com saw fluctuating weekly revenue, peaking early at approximately $11.2K but stabilizing around $3K to $5K towards the end of the quarter. Weekly downloads remained steady, hovering between 4.7K and 5.9K, while weekly active users consistently stayed above 170K, showing slight variations.
Disney Coloring World by StoryToys Limited experienced modest revenue, averaging around $1.1K to $1.4K weekly. Downloads peaked mid-quarter at 1.5K but gradually declined to about 600 by the quarter's end. Active users followed a similar trend, starting at 1.6K and ending at 1.2K.
Asphalt 8: Airborne from Gameloft maintained consistent revenue, generally ranging from $400 to $600 per week. Downloads varied, starting strong at 1.6K, dipping mid-quarter, and recovering to 1.4K towards the end. Active user numbers showed a decline from 10.9K to 7.8K over the quarter.
Crayola Create and Play: Kids by Crayola had low but steady revenue, mostly between $200 and $400 weekly. Downloads showed significant growth, starting under 100 and peaking at 880 by the quarter's end. Active users also rose from 186 to 887, reflecting increased engagement.
Finally, Hill Climb Racing from Fingersoft experienced consistent downloads, with numbers fluctuating between 6K and 9K. Revenue remained stable, typically around $200 to $400 weekly. Active users started at 56K, slightly decreasing to around 42K.
